Tax payment critical for quick realization of Soludo’s ambitious plan – Mefor
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terShare on Whatsapp

Chinedum Treasure

Anambra Commissioner for Information, Dr. Law Mefor has described tax payment as necessary for quick realisation of Soludo’s ambitious plan for the development of the State.

Mefor stated this during a courtesy visit to the Chairman/Executive Officer, Anambra State Internal Revenue Service (AIRS), Dr. Greg Ezeilo, at his office in Awka.

He said the visit was to familiarise himself with the institution and its management and see what could be done to sensitise Ndị Anambra on tax payment.

According to him, Governor Soludo has a lot of mega projects ongoing in various parts of the state, which will be realised fully and in good time if the internally generated revenue is improved.

“When the Governor is crying about revenue, we can understand because he has a lot of mega multi-billion naira projects across the state, which is a testimony that he is putting the taxpayers’ money to good use.

“It’s a lot of pressure on you, and we are there in the Ministry of Information to help. We want to work with you, and we are ready to do whatever can be done to sensitise our people to understand that payment of tax is necessary, especially as the state does not get much from the centre, so we have to survive from inside,” he added.

Dr. Mefor commended Ndị Anambra for their support so far to the Soludo-led administration through the payment of taxes and urged them to do more.

“I’m sure that if Ndị Anambra are well mobilised and sensitised that their money is being put to use, they will be happy to pay their tax regularly. That’s why I keep saying that Governor Soludo’s achievements are underreported.

“Our people need to know about the achievements of the Soludo government and the projects and programmes in the works. Information ministry will therefore join hands with AIRS for a massive public enlightenment on tax compliance by our people,” he said.

Responding, AIRS Chairman, Dr. Ezeilo, stated that Anambra is making much progress under Governor Soludo through internally generated revenue from his office. He added that he is convinced that other states will soon come to study Anambra’s revenue generation management.

Ezeilo, who used the opportunity to conduct the commissioner round the office, presented various awards won by AIRS as the best-performing government institution in the South-East, among others.
